How to Combat Fatigue and Boost Fertility Naturally

Fatigue can affect both daily productivity and reproductive health. Men with persistent fatigue may experience a decline in sperm count and quality, while women might face hormonal imbalances that impair fertility. Fortunately, there are natural and practical strategies to combat fatigue and improve fertility health.


1. Identify Underlying Health Issues

  • Fatigue can be a symptom of medical conditions such as:
    • Thyroid disorders
    • Anemia
    • Heart disease
    • Sleep apnea
    • Chronic illnesses
  • Action Step: If fatigue is unusual or persistent, consult a doctor to rule out medical causes or medication side effects.

2. Stay Hydrated

  • Dehydration is a common but often overlooked cause of fatigue.
  • What to Do:
    • Prioritize water over caffeine or energy drinks.
    • Aim for 8–10 glasses of water daily to stay hydrated and boost energy.
  • Fertility Benefits:
    • Hydration aids in improving blood flow and hormone regulation.

3. Take Breaks to Recharge

  • Overloading your day without rest can exacerbate fatigue.
  • Tips for Effective Breaks:
    • Step away from tasks for 5–10 minutes periodically.
    • Engage in stress-reducing activities like:
      • Listening to music
      • Practicing deep breathing
      • Spending time outdoors
  • Why It Matters:
    • Breaks reduce stress, which can otherwise harm fertility, and enhance overall productivity.

4. Incorporate Regular Exercise

  • Physical activity boosts energy levels and fights fatigue.
  • Best Practices:
    • Start small: Take walks, stretch, or practice yoga.
    • Build a routine with moderate exercise 3–5 times a week.
  • Fertility Benefits:
    • Regular fitness helps maintain a healthy weight, enhances mood, and supports hormonal balance.

5. Optimize Your Diet

  • A balanced, nutrient-rich diet is key to combating fatigue and promoting fertility.
  • Dietary Tips:
    • Avoid sugar-loaded snacks that cause energy crashes.
    • Include:
      • Whole grains for sustained energy
      • Lean proteins for muscle recovery
      • Fruits and vegetables for essential vitamins
  • Fertility-Specific Nutrients:
    • Zinc, Vitamin E, and Omega-3 fatty acids are particularly beneficial for reproductive health.
